What are some common challenges faced by professionals working in cost-control or procurement roles, and how can they be addressed?

Professionals in cost-control or procurement roles often encounter challenges such as negotiating with suppliers for the best prices, balancing cost savings with quality, and staying updated on market trends. These roles require strong analytical skills to identify cost-saving opportunities while ensuring that organizational standards are met. Collaboration with various departments and clear communication are crucial to successfully implement cost-effective solutions. Continuous learning and leveraging procurement software can also help streamline processes and manage supplier relationships more effectively.

We're looking for an Infrastructure Engineer to own the execution layer beneath our RL environments: the systems that let an agent operate inside a realistic, multi-tool world coherently for hours or days.

This is a hard systems problem disguised as an AI job.
As the tasks agents can complete keep lengthening, the environments that train them have to stay coherent across far longer horizons than anything that exists today.
That means sandboxing and isolation you can trust, execution that's fast and cheap enough to run at training scale, and the ability to snapshot, restore, inspect, and branch a running environment instead of treating every rollout as one-shot. You'll build the platform that makes all of this possible.

You'll work closely with our research and data teams, and directly with frontier labs and enterprise customers, to turn environment designs into infrastructure that runs reliably in production.
